The only way I have found to do this is:
- Highlight the clip by single clicking on it.
- Advance the clip to a frame that has an image, by pressing the Tab Key then using the Right Arrow Key, or clicking once in the Timecode display, (00:00:00:00) on the far right numbers (frames), then click the Up arrow beside it to advance the clip.
- Press the Mark-In "[" button. (F3 on the keyboard).
Basically what we have just done is trimmed the black frames from the front of the clip...
